Financing MCO Efforts to Identify and Address Health-Related Social Needs

To scale and sustain health-related social needs services (HRSN) and support community providers, Medicaid-managed care organizations need predictable funding. A new report from the Center for Health Care Strategies explores how 12 states finance HRSN activities and shares recommendations to guide future efforts that bridge health and social care.
